Warranty Deed issues, Is there a way around it ?

I currently have a property under contract, the "owner" that lives there got the home transferred to him via quit-claim deed. But we need a special warranty deed signed by the initial owner, since it was never warrantied to the occupant currently there though he's been in there 4 years.

Is there anyway other way to get it done it the occupant doesn't want us to send a mobile notary to the previous owners ? Or is he up to some shady business ? (which I'm starting to feel).
